This album was great for any Fish listener. While not as Ska-heavy as Turn the Radio Off and Why do they Rock so Hard, it is a refreshing turn around from Cheer Up, which was completely different from all other RBF albums and the peak of them being sell outs. This album lyrically bashes their record label as well as the whole music industry more than ever before, and ultimately, finally freed them from Jive. I'd describe RBF as the happiest angry band ever, and this album brings it out entirely. These lyrics are some of the most anger-filled words ever, tied in with RBF's signiture up-beat sound. I'd recommend this album for all lovers of the RBF, young and old.

If your looking for a great punk-styled album look no further. This Anti-Flag offering is amazing with 8 new tracks and 8 live classics. The 8 new tracks are great, fast, and political offerings and the live tracks are all played to near perfection. This album is ideal for anyone who enjoys fast music, with meaning, and Mobilize gives a nice insight to older Anti-Flag material with the live tracks. I wholly recommend this album, and for people looking to get into Anti-Flag this is a great place to start.

The record does what it says in the title...The Monomen were a band with songs. As such they were kinda average. On this mini-album, they threw away the microphones...and triumphed.
Released in amongst a slew of garage and surf revival records in the early nineties, this was one of the best. Skuzzy, full throttle, sleazy and hardcore. There isn't much describing it really. If you love Dick Dale and the like, you can't fail to fall for this one. Sometimes records don't have to mean much - energy is all they need. Its here in abundance.
